The Confederate by John W. Flores is a biography that explores the life of Lucien Flournoy, a notable Texas oilman and liberal Democratic benefactor. Published by AuthorHouse on November 29, 2020, this edition comprises 240 pages and is presented in English. The book delves into Flournoy’s experiences and contributions, providing insights into his significant role in the oil industry and his political affiliations.

Readers will find a detailed account of Flournoy’s life from his birth in 1919 to his passing in 2003. The narrative captures the essence of his character and the impact he had on both the business and political landscapes. This biography offers a comprehensive look at Flournoy’s journey, highlighting key moments and influences that shaped his legacy in Texas and beyond.
